This page provides the latest information on Southern University at New Orleans (SUNO)'s admission process, acceptance rate, and student profile. SUNO's acceptance rate is 78.90% for 2024-2025 admission. A total of 6,526 students applied and 5,149 were admitted to the school. Its acceptance rate is relatively high, making it somewhat easy to get into SUNO.
To apply to SUNO, it is required to submit high school GPA and record. The SAT and ACT score is not required, but considered for admission. In addition, english proficiency test score is also considered (required).
For the academic year 2024-25, SUNO's acceptance rate is 78.90% and the yield (also known as enrollment rate) is 3.17%. 1,523 men and 5,003 women applied to SUNO and 1,181 men and 3,968 women students were accepted.
Among them, 63 men and 100 women were enrolled in SUNO. You can explore the SUNO's admission rates and SAT score trends over the past decade, including year-by-year data and analysis, by visiting Admission Trends page.

For the academic year 2025, 17 students (10% of enrolled students) submitted SAT scores and 104 students (64% of enrolled students) submitted ACT scores as part of the admission process at SUNO.
The median SAT score for admitted students is 910, including 480 in S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ing (EBRW) and 430 in SAT Math. The 75th percentile SAT EBRW score is 540 and the 25th percentile is 410. For SAT Math, the 75th percentile score is 510 and the 25th percentile is 410.
The median ACT composite score is 17, with a 75th percentile score of 20 and a 25th percentile score of 15 at SUNO. The median ACT Math score is 16 and the median ACT English score is 16.
The SAT and ACT scores at Southern University at New Orleans are relatively low compared to similar colleges (SAT: 1,078, ACT: 22 - public master's college and university with medium programs).

For the academic year 2024-25, total 163 first-year students enrolled in SUNO. The proportion of full-time students is 98.16% and part-time students is 1.84%.
By gender, the proportion of men students is 38.65% and women students is 61.35%.

It requires to submit High School GPA, High School Record (or Transcript), and English Proficiency Test to its applicants.
The SAT and ACT test score is not required, but considered in admission process at SUNO. The english proficiency test is required .

The institutional SAT code for SUNO is 1647 and 4-digit ACT code is 1611.
